Elton John-Madman Across The Water

Another one from 1971 and another used re-issue from 1980 that I bought some time ago. Side one is what I always listened to. “Tiny Dancer” and “Levon” were singles played on AM radio all the time back in the early 70’s. FM radio played “Madman Across The Water” one of my favorites by him. There is an earlier version with Mick Ronson on guitar without the orchestration that I like better that was on the Rare Masters CD I had at one time. Listening to side two I hardly recognized any of the songs except for “Rotten Peaches”. Like his last album he used mostly session players. Paul Buckmaster’s orchestration is a big part of the sound on this record. Sometimes a bit too much.
